Litchi and Autopilot state there is an issue with 500 firmware.
Litchi says to not use certain flight mode until a DJI firmware update

No comment from DJI


Read this
Dear Litchi Pilots,


There is currently an issue with the recently released firmwares for Mavic Pro (v01.03.0500), Inspire 2 (v01.0.0240) and Phantom 4 Pro (v01.03.0418) where the drone will fly erratically in some of Litchi’s flight modes. If you already installed one of these firmwares, we highly recommend not using these flight modes until the issue is fixed with a DJI firmware update. The following flight modes are affected: VR with Immersive/Joystick Head Tracking active, Follow, Focus and Track. All other flight modes (including FPV, Waypoint, Orbit and VR with Immersive/Joystick Head Tracking OFF) are unaffected.


The Litchi Team

So, continuing my investigation, I can in fact conclude that .500 was the cause of the drunken hover. Downgraded to .400 and flew it today on 2 different flights and it flew like a champ. The hover was back to rock solid. Also improved my range over flying with .500. I could barely get a mile with .500. In the two flights I took today in the same spot running .400, I was able to achieve 10500 feet before almost losing it and on the second flight I took it to 11700 and still couldve kept going. I turned back to make sure I had enough juice in the tank. Bottom line for me: I will be avoiding .500 and sticking with .400. Much more stable.
